After entering the Foreign Ministry, Li Shengjiao worked in the Department of Treaty and Law, and became rated a promising asset to the Ministry. He participated in a series of boundary negotiations, working with the Foreign Ministry's Boundary and Ocean Affairs Department. Pictured is various staff with the Department of Treaty and Law at the Chinese Ministry of Foreign Affairs in 1957. Li Shengjiao is second on the left in the back row. Today marks the first anniversary of the death of Li Shengjiao, a distinguished Chinese diplomat. He was among the first generation of diplomats who were sent abroad following the establishment of People's Republic of China in 1949. He was praised by former Chinese Premier Zhou Enlai for his talent and contributions. He represented China in multiple international meetings and negotiations, with authorities saying he made major contributions to China's national interests. His research results also received high recognition from Chairman Mao, Premier Zhou and other top Chinese leaders.
